Social Studies

The Montour High School Social Studies Department Course of Study reflects a rigorous and relevant comprehensive curriculum focused on United States History, Global Studies, Economics, and Poltical Systems. The course of study includes both honors, advanced placement (AP), and college in the high school (CHS) courses along with a menu of elective course offerings including; Pyschology, Sociology, and America and the Modern World.

Each of the grade level specific courses reflect curriculum that is aligned to the Pennsylvania State Standards.
